Bible Verses for Encouragement
- Isaiah 41:10 – "Fear not, for I am with you; be not dismayed, for I am your God. I will strengthen you, I will help you, I will uphold you with my righteous right hand."
- Philippians 4:13 – "I can do all things through Christ who strengthens me."
- Psalm 46:1 – "God is our refuge and strength, a very present help in trouble."
How to Offer Spiritual Encouragement to a Friend
Be Present and Listen
Sometimes, the best way to support a friend is simply by being there. Offer a listening ear without judgment and let them express their feelings.
Send a Thoughtful Message or Prayer
If your friend is feeling down, send them a heartfelt text or prayer. A simple message of daily spiritual inspiration can remind them that they are loved and supported.
Share a Devotional or Inspirational Book
Gifting a devotional book or an uplifting scripture-based journal can help your friend find strength and guidance in their faith journey.
Encourage Self-Care and Faith-Based Practices
Remind them to take care of themselves—spiritually, emotionally, and physically. Encourage prayer, meditation, or even spending time in nature to find peace.
